BHUBANESWAR, India — Maoist rebels in India on Sunday released one of two Italian men who were kidnapped 11 days ago while on an adventure holiday trekking in the eastern state of Orissa.
"It was a frightening experience. For the last four days, I was being promised that I will be released," Claudio Colangelo, a 61-year-old tourist from Rome, told the NDTV news channel after being freed.
"Finally it has happened. I hope Paolo (Bosusco) is released soon. I hope they understand that Paolo has nothing to do with this war."
